Europe’s weekend news is dominated by sudden violence and a large-scale rescue emergency. Authorities in the eastern Mediterranean and central Europe are mounting urgent operations after a ferry capsizes off northern Cyprus and separate attacks in Switzerland and Germany leave people dead and injured.
A major rescue operation is underway after a catamaran ferry capsizes off northern Cyprus with roughly 270 people on board. The vessel is reported to be traveling between Turkish Cypriot ports and Turkey, and emergency teams are searching for passengers as authorities work to determine the full scale of the incident.
Swiss police are hunting for the gunman after a shooting at a rave near Aarau kills one person and injures five others. The attack unfolds in the early hours, triggering a large emergency response and a manhunt as investigators try to identify and locate the suspect.
A 31-year-old British woman dies after being stabbed at Rosenheim railway station in Bavaria, and a 27-year-old man is in custody. Emergency crews respond shortly after midnight, take the woman to hospital, and police open a homicide investigation into the killing.
